OK y'all I think I solved my problem. After sticking to the diet...I mean WOE for 3 weeks I was still having Keto Flulike symptoms. More...er...adequate water wasn't helping.
After reading many past threads here I realized I needed to up my electrolytes big time. At first I was concerned about getting too much. I decided on a plan and put it into action and I feel much better all ready.
Yesterday I bought No Salt made by French's and Epson salts. I added some Epson salts (2 handfuls) to a foot soak. I measured out 1/4 tsp of the No Salt (640 mg) and used it a little at a time over the day. I also used about 1/4 tsp table salt and ate some salty cheese. So that covered three of my electrolytes.
I made myself a sports drink out of some Celestial Seasons Wild Berry herbal tea with some sucralose and some No Salt and NaCl.
I was able to do a nice walk with a couple hills with no stopping because my heart was pounding so hard I thought it would come out of my chest.
I am so happy I feel better because I was contemplating going off the plan.
